Opinion

Per Curiam:

Writ of error dismissed for want of jurisdiction. Stevens, Administrator, v. Nichols, 157 U. S. 370; Loeber v. Schroeder, 149 U. S. 580; Central Land Co. v. Laidley, 159 U. S. 103; Backus v. Fort Street Union Depot Co., 169 U. S. 557; Ballard v. Hunter, 204 U. S. 241; Tracy v. Ginsberg, 205 U. S. 180; Rusch v. John Duncan Land & Mining Co., 211 U. S. 526; reported below, 218 Illinois, 571.
